Watertown sits in an area of Carver County that sees frequent freeze-thaw cycling through late winter and early spring, and that repeated expansion and contraction is hard on shingles even when no single storm event stands out. Roofs that look fine after a mild winter can still show accelerated cracking and seam failure from months of temperature swings running from single digits to the forties and back. If your roof is more than ten years old, that cumulative stress is worth a look before it shows up as a leak.

How much does a new roof cost in Watertown?
In Carver County, residential roof replacements typically range from $9,000 to $17,000. Newer lake-area homes with steeper pitches often fall on the higher end. If your Watertown home has storm damage from a recent hail or wind event, your homeowner's insurance may cover all or most of the replacement. We provide free written estimates so you know exactly where you stand before committing to anything.

Will my homeowner's insurance cover my Watertown roof if it has storm damage?
Whether your insurance covers it comes down to the cause and how well the damage is documented at the time of the claim. If a hail or wind event caused the damage, your policy should cover it minus your deductible, but the documentation has to clearly connect the damage to a specific weather event. We attend the adjuster inspection with you so that the findings we put in our report are the same ones the adjuster is working from, and nothing significant gets overlooked or left out of the claim.
What credentials should I look for in a Watertown roofing contractor?
Any contractor working on your Watertown home should be able to hand you a valid Minnesota license number on the spot and encourage you to verify it at the Department of Labor and Industry website. Bold North Exteriors holds MN license BC795118 and is IKO certified, which means we've met manufacturer standards for installation quality, not just general contractor requirements. Beyond credentials, ask whether they pull permits and whether they'll attend the adjuster inspection with you — those two things tell you a lot about how a contractor actually operates.
